Transaction 686048c45895c2846f9d4963a201127fcf94505569b7c83c80183b53ec1eaf1d
1 Input
1 Output
-
686048c45895c2846f9d4963a201127fcf94505569b7c83c80183b53ec1eaf1d:0
- value
- 34466
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0b3ad4eb1f6577dce802daf3939c5cfe88dcb7ece3cc02bc556b67bf0aa6c365
- address
- bc1ppvadf6clv4mae6qzmtee88zul6ydedlvu0xq90z4ddnm7z4xcdjswa36fg